Web8 apr. 2024 · Therapy for migraine attacks includes non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s), combination analgesics, ergotamine preparations and migraine-specific medications. The latter class, which until a few years ago meant triptans, has recently grown to include ditans, serotonin 5HT 1F receptor agonists, and gepants, CGRP receptor …
